(a) Calculate the theoretical lattice energy for the salt CaF2. (b) The hydration enthalpy of Ca²+ is –1592 kJ mol-1; the hydration enthalpy of F¯ is –497 kJ mol-. Calculate the enthalpy of precipitation of CaF2. (c) Ignoring entropy effects, use the results of your calculations to predict whether CaF; is soluble or insoluble. Can entropy effects generally safely be ignored in questions like this?
